Output 953226e3bde3d3fdeb42bbe52c9bc81d44bfa89b72ec6cd7d8e64636b3ac25f6:26

value
615000
script pubkey
OP_0 OP_PUSHBYTES_20 dfc004dcd928c3da40c45cf2eca126a3a048a034
address
bc1qmlqqfhxe9rpa5sxytnewegfx5wsy3gp5kwjj9k
transaction
953226e3bde3d3fdeb42bbe52c9bc81d44bfa89b72ec6cd7d8e64636b3ac25f6